イーサリアム(ETH)の最新ネットワークアップデート



イーサリアム(ETH)の最新ネットワークアップデート


イーサリアム(ETH)の最新ネットワークアップデート

イーサリアムは、分散型アプリケーション(DApps)を構築するための基盤となるブロックチェーンプラットフォームであり、その継続的な進化は、暗号資産業界全体に大きな影響を与えています。本稿では、イーサリアムの主要なネットワークアップデートについて、技術的な詳細、導入の背景、そして将来への展望を含めて詳細に解説します。

1. イーサリアムの基礎とアップデートの必要性

イーサリアムは、ビットコインと同様にブロックチェーン技術を基盤としていますが、スマートコントラクトという独自の機能を有しています。スマートコントラクトは、事前に定義された条件が満たされた場合に自動的に実行されるプログラムであり、金融、サプライチェーン管理、投票システムなど、様々な分野での応用が期待されています。

しかし、イーサリアムの初期の設計には、スケーラビリティの問題が存在していました。トランザクション処理能力が低く、ネットワークの混雑時にはガス代(トランザクション手数料)が高騰するという課題がありました。また、プルーフ・オブ・ワーク(PoW)というコンセンサスアルゴリズムは、エネルギー消費量が大きいという批判も受けていました。これらの課題を解決するために、イーサリアムの開発チームは、継続的にネットワークアップデートを実施しています。

2. 主要なネットワークアップデートの概要

2.1. Byzantium (ビザンティウム)

2017年10月に実施されたByzantiumアップデートは、イーサリアムの仮想マシン(EVM)の改善に焦点を当てました。具体的には、以下の点が改善されました。

  • EVMの最適化: EVMの実行効率が向上し、スマートコントラクトの実行速度が改善されました。
  • 新しいプリコンパイル: 暗号化関数などの計算コストの高い処理を効率的に実行するためのプリコンパイルが追加されました。
  • セキュリティの強化: スマートコントラクトの脆弱性を軽減するためのセキュリティ対策が導入されました。

Byzantiumアップデートは、イーサリアムの基盤となる技術を強化し、より複雑なスマートコントラクトの開発を可能にしました。

2.2. Constantinople (コンスタンティノープル)

2019年2月に実施されたConstantinopleアップデートは、EVMのさらなる改善と、ガス代の削減に焦点を当てました。主な変更点は以下の通りです。

  • ガス代の削減: スマートコントラクトの実行に必要なガス代が大幅に削減され、トランザクションコストが低下しました。
  • 新しいopcodeの導入: スマートコントラクトの開発を容易にするための新しいopcodeが導入されました。
  • セキュリティの強化: スマートコントラクトの脆弱性を軽減するためのセキュリティ対策が導入されました。

Constantinopleアップデートは、イーサリアムの利用コストを削減し、より多くの開発者やユーザーがイーサリアムを利用できるようにしました。

2.3. Istanbul (イスタンブール)

2019年12月に実施されたIstanbulアップデートは、EVMの改善と、プライバシー保護機能の強化に焦点を当てました。主な変更点は以下の通りです。

  • EVMの最適化: EVMの実行効率がさらに向上し、スマートコントラクトの実行速度が改善されました。
  • Zk-SNARKsのサポート: ゼロ知識証明の一種であるZk-SNARKsのサポートが追加され、プライバシー保護機能が強化されました。
  • ガス代の削減: スマートコントラクトの実行に必要なガス代がさらに削減され、トランザクションコストが低下しました。

Istanbulアップデートは、イーサリアムのパフォーマンスを向上させ、プライバシー保護機能を強化することで、より高度なDAppsの開発を可能にしました。

2.4. Berlin (ベルリン)

2021年4月に実施されたBerlinアップデートは、EVMの改善と、ガス代の最適化に焦点を当てました。主な変更点は以下の通りです。

  • ガス代の最適化: スマートコントラクトの実行に必要なガス代が最適化され、トランザクションコストが低下しました。
  • EVMの改善: EVMの実行効率が向上し、スマートコントラクトの実行速度が改善されました。
  • 新しいopcodeの導入: スマートコントラクトの開発を容易にするための新しいopcodeが導入されました。

Berlinアップデートは、イーサリアムの利用コストを削減し、より効率的なDAppsの開発を可能にしました。

2.5. London (ロンドン) – EIP-1559

2021年8月に実施されたLondonアップデートは、EIP-1559という重要な提案を導入しました。EIP-1559は、イーサリアムのトランザクション手数料の仕組みを大きく変更しました。従来のオークション形式ではなく、ベースフィーと優先手数料という2つの要素で構成されるようになりました。

  • ベースフィー: トランザクションをブロックに含めるための最低限の手数料であり、ネットワークの混雑状況に応じて動的に調整されます。
  • 優先手数料: マイナーにトランザクションを優先的に処理してもらうための手数料であり、ユーザーが任意に設定できます。

EIP-1559の導入により、ガス代の予測可能性が向上し、トランザクション手数料の変動が抑制されました。また、ベースフィーはETHをバーン(焼却)されるため、ETHの供給量が減少するという効果も期待されています。

2.6. The Merge (ザ・マージ) – PoSへの移行

2022年9月に実施されたThe Mergeは、イーサリアムのコンセンサスアルゴリズムをプルーフ・オブ・ワーク(PoW)からプルーフ・オブ・ステーク(PoS)に移行する歴史的なアップデートでした。PoSは、PoWと比較してエネルギー消費量が大幅に少なく、より環境に優しいコンセンサスアルゴリズムです。

The Mergeにより、イーサリアムのセキュリティが向上し、スケーラビリティの問題の解決に向けた道が開かれました。また、ETHのインフレ率が低下し、ETHの価値が向上するという効果も期待されています。

3. 今後のアップデートと展望

The Mergeの完了後も、イーサリアムの開発チームは、さらなるネットワークアップデートを計画しています。主なアップデートとしては、以下のものが挙げられます。

  • Sharding (シャーディング): ブロックチェーンを複数のシャード(断片)に分割し、トランザクション処理能力を向上させる技術です。
  • Verkle Trees (バークルトリーズ): イーサリアムの状態サイズを削減し、ノードの同期時間を短縮する技術です。
  • Proto-Danksharding (プロト・ダンクシャーディング): シャーディングの導入に向けた準備段階として、データ可用性サンプリングという技術を導入するアップデートです。

これらのアップデートにより、イーサリアムは、よりスケーラブルで、効率的で、安全なブロックチェーンプラットフォームへと進化していくことが期待されます。また、イーサリアムは、DeFi(分散型金融)、NFT(非代替性トークン)、メタバースなど、様々な分野での応用が拡大していくと考えられます。

4. まとめ

イーサリアムは、継続的なネットワークアップデートを通じて、その技術的な課題を克服し、進化を続けています。Byzantium、Constantinople、Istanbul、Berlin、London、そしてThe Mergeといった主要なアップデートは、イーサリアムのパフォーマンス、セキュリティ、そしてスケーラビリティを向上させました。今後のアップデートにより、イーサリアムは、ブロックチェーン業界におけるリーダーとしての地位を確立し、より多くの人々に利用されるプラットフォームへと成長していくでしょう。イーサリアムの進化は、暗号資産業界全体の発展に不可欠であり、その動向から目が離せません。


前の記事

リスク(LSK)で参加できる最新ICO情報まとめ!

次の記事

ヘデラ(HBAR)分散型アプリ開発のメリットを解説

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です